Chaetoceros tetrachaeta

Chaetoceros tetrachaeta

Description

Chaetoceros tetrachaeta is a species of marine diatom that acts as a significant hazard in aquaculture systems. While not a conventional plant disease, its presence in high densities poses a severe biological threat to farmed fish populations by causing extensive physical damage to their respiratory organs.

The primary mechanism of harm is mechanical. These diatoms possess long, sharp spines that become lodged in the gill filaments of fish as they respire. This penetration causes acute irritation, inflammation, and cellular destruction, leaving the gills vulnerable to secondary opportunistic pathogens and severely impairing the fish's oxygen exchange capacity.

This biological hazard affects various species cultivated in marine or brackish water environments. The susceptibility is highest in high-density farming operations where fish cannot escape the bloom areas. Salmonids and other marine finfish are particularly prone to these injuries, often resulting in high mortality rates during bloom events.

Development and spread are heavily dependent on environmental conditions, particularly nutrient enrichment (eutrophication) and rising water temperatures. Under favorable conditions, this diatom can undergo rapid proliferation, turning the water into an abrasive suspension that is lethal to fish stocks within a matter of days.

Effective management and prevention strategies are essential for maintaining farm profitability:

  • Implement proactive phytoplankton monitoring programs to detect early signs of a bloom.
  • Utilize deep-water pumping systems to bypass surface-level bloom concentrations.
  • Reduce stocking density and stop feeding during intense bloom events to minimize metabolic stress.
  • Establish contingency plans for emergency harvesting or relocating cages to cleaner water zones.
